Good Timing
While the holidays aren’t necessarily “peak moving season”, movers still tend to be very busy during this period. So if you’re planning a move you should call early and book your spot.

 

Know your budget

With all the gift-buying and travel expenses, your budget may already be stretched thin. When you add in the moving expenses, you’re most likely going to need to look for ways to tighten your belt. When hiring movers, your best bet is to book a mid-week move and avoid moving on a holiday weekend, since moving companies tend to be short-staffed during those periods.
 

Smart packing
If you live for the holiday season, then there's nothing more discouraging than an undecorated home amid the November and December months. To help prepare for quick holiday set-up when you move into your new place, be sure to pack all Christmas decorations, ornaments, gift wrapping, gifts, and holiday clothing in clearly identified/ labelled boxes and request that the movers place them in your living room when they get to your new home.


Make donations
Giving your things away may not be the most energizing part of moving, but it's absolutely a suitable activity amid the Christmas season. Charities will happily accept your things and it costs you nothing. Alternatively, if you’ve bought gifts or made financial donations, you ought to save your receipts, as the holiday season denotes the end of the tax year. These gifts could put more dollars in your own pockets – and after a move, that is something to be thankful for!

Think about your family!

In case you're intending to move your children amidst the school year, be ready to help them with this transition period. Ensure their reports and school records are exchanged to the new school in a timely manner. Generally, this implies transcripts, report cards, vaccination records, other such documents and records.
